The Doctoral Program in Mathematics and Natural Sciences (MIPA) extends its congratulations and appreciation to Suparno, a doctoral (S3) student, for his outstanding achievement at the 15th Asian Control Conference (ASCC) 2026. At this prestigious international conference, Suparno received the Best 3 Indonesian Student Paper Award for his scientific presentation entitled “An Optimal Control of a Non-Dimensional Malaria Model Using Real Data.”
ASCC 2026 is a highly prestigious international conference in the field of control systems, held on June 17–21, 2026, in Nusa Dua, Bali. The conference brings together academics, researchers, students, and practitioners from various countries to present the latest research in control systems, automation, robotics, artificial intelligence, and related fields. All accepted and presented papers are also published through the IEEE Xplore Digital Library.
The award received by Suparno is a recognition of his research quality, scientific contribution, and presentation skills demonstrated throughout the conference. The student category award at ASCC is granted to the best student-led scientific papers, with evaluation criteria covering the quality of technical contribution and presentation performance.
